SAM and KAI wedding photography Cagayan de Oro City
Serendipity is the word that generally defines these fun-loving couple. After listening to the accounts of the people who described their past relationships it was really God’s will that this two were destined to meet each other. Not only by chance that they were assigned to work on the same hospital in Malaybalay City, their parents are also close friends who are on the same Church that they attend to. With God’s will and plenty of friends’ help I guess, they crossed paths, fell in love and now tied the knot. It was an intricate God’s plan to really describe it. And maybe it was also God’s plan that this two stumbled on my website and got me to immortalize how fun and in-love this two are through photographs. It was really a joyous occasion and I had fun taking pictures.

JOMAR and CRIS wedding photography Cagayan de Oro City
It was my first to cover a wedding in ECO CHURCH in Kauswagan. I have heard from other suppliers that this church is very strict and there are already suppliers that were banned with reasons I don’t know. Even the couple briefed me that the officiating priest is also very strict. During shoots, I try not to be so moving as not to be distracting especially in the Church but after hearing all those warnings, I was a bit pressured. It can be difficult to shoot when you’re under pressure, whether you’re aiming to capture her Seventy-seven Diamonds accessories, or the page boy holding the ring-pillow aloft. Lots of “what ifs” went into my mind that day like “what if I didn’t captured those moments that I should take because I got reprimanded of some sort.” Aside from the humid day, everything went well eventually. We were still able to squeeze a few minutes to take a post wedding pictorial right after the ceremony and my onsite presentation were shown smoothly. Thank you Lord!
